Walking to Heaven (1959)
If there has ever been pure and undestroyable love, this is it. That is how Imre and Vera feel. The talented chemist loses his best friend for the girl's sake, then gives up his profession, only to be able to stay in the capital with Vera. But the young actress at the beginning of her career is neglected. Imre accepts an uninteresting, but well-paying position. They seem to be happy together.
